Bollywood star Ajay Devgn has wrapped up shooting for ‘Dhamaal 4’, the much-awaited next instalment in the hit comedy franchise. The film is now slated to hit theatres on Eid 2026, promising fans another round of laughter, chaos, and high-energy entertainment.
According to industry updates, the shooting was completed earlier this week, marking a major milestone for the project. The ‘Dhamaal’ series, which began in 2007, has consistently entertained audiences with its quirky characters, slapstick humour, and ensemble cast-driven madness. With Devgn leading the charge, ‘Dhamaal 4’ is expected to up the scale with bigger set pieces, fresh comic punches, and a storyline designed to connect with both loyal fans of the franchise and new viewers.
Directed by Indra Kumar, who has helmed the previous instalments, the upcoming film continues the tradition of rib-tickling comedy and adventurous twists. The team is now moving into post-production to gear up for its grand festival release.
With Eid 2026 locked for its arrival, ‘Dhamaal 4’ is expected to clash with other big-ticket releases, setting the stage for a power-packed holiday weekend at the box office.
